Output 31cc262315b22bb67a3f677d45a910507904c69294b08ba20e66201572426dfb:1

value
14776008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cc57db26d662e24874bfe2a4e14fed30d7f0387 OP_EQUAL
address
MDSVMraE51zHd6uRExmwZzAEpTLJCULkBR
transaction
31cc262315b22bb67a3f677d45a910507904c69294b08ba20e66201572426dfb
spent
true